Understanding the Portuguese Driver's License System
In Portugal, the driver's license system is controlled by the Instituto da Mobilidade e dos Transportes (IMT). It follows a structured framework to make sure the security of drivers and pedestrians alike. Typically, to drive lawfully in Portugal, one must pass a written and practical driving examination. However, specific circumstances permit individuals to obtain a license without taking these tests.
Who Can Apply for a Portuguese Driver's License Without a Test?
The following categories of people might receive a Portuguese motorist's license without taking the actual driving tests:
EU/EEA License Holders: Citizens of EU or EEA member mentions with a legitimate driver's license can exchange their license for a Portuguese one. This procedure does not usually need a test.
Sworn Diplomats: Diplomats, consular officers, and their relative might be qualified to exchange their licenses under specific conditions.
Third Country Nationals with a License: Nationals from nations outside the EU/EEA that possess a legitimate motorist's license might likewise examine if their country has a reciprocal agreement with Portugal for license exchange.

Q1: Can I drive in Portugal with my foreign license?
A1: Yes, non-EU/EEA residents can drive with their foreign license for as much as 185 days after showing up in Portugal. After that, they need to exchange it for a Portuguese license if they mean to stay longer.
Q2: Is there a charge for exchanging my chauffeur's license?
A2: Yes, there is a processing fee needed when you apply for the exchange of your license. Charges may vary depending upon the license category.
Q3: How long is a Portuguese motorist's license valid?
A3: The credibility of a Portuguese motorist's license typically lasts for 10 years for many categories, after which it should be restored.
Q4: What if my original license is ended?
A4: If your original license is expired, you might not be eligible for exchange without first restoring it in your home nation.
Q5: Can I use for a Portuguese chauffeur's license online?
A5: Currently, the initial application needs to be made personally at an IMT workplace, though some forms and consultations may be helped with online.
